Mr. Musk’s corporate exodus from Delaware began before Tesla compensation was invalidated, but accelerated dramatically in the weeks following the ruling. Let’s see where his main legal entity is registered.

space x

Space Exploration Technologies Corporation (commonly known as SpaceX) has maintained its business registration status. Delaware to Texas On Wednesday, February 14th, Musk announced in a post on X, “SpaceX has moved its state of incorporation from Delaware to Texas!”

SpaceX’s private company status allowed Musk to easily change its structure without the scrutiny that comes with moving to a publicly traded company.

tesla

Electric vehicle giant Tesla has been incorporated in Delaware since its founding in 2003, and its status as a publicly traded company makes it difficult for Musk’s company to change its state of registration given the potential for investor lawsuits. is the most difficult.

In the wake of Delaware judgment Musk annulled his compensation package at the company he founded, so we surveyed X users about whether they should move the company to Texas, and respondents overwhelmingly agreed with the idea.

“The people’s vote is unequivocally in favor of Texas!” Musk declared after the vote closed. “Tesla will immediately hold a shareholder vote to transfer its state of incorporation to Texas.”

Neither Musk nor Tesla has said when a shareholder vote on changing the company’s registration status will take place. Tesla did not immediately respond to inquiries regarding this matter.

X (old Twitter)

What happened to the investor group led by Musk? acquired twitter He bought the company for $44 billion in October 2022 and took it private, but Musk reincorporated the company in Nevada in April 2023, at the same time rebranding the social media platform as X.

boring company

Founded by Musk boring company (TBC) was founded as a subsidiary of Tesla in 2017 and spun off as an independent venture the following year. TBC provides tunnel construction and equipment services for projects such as the Las Vegas Convention Center Loop, an underground tunnel network that serves as a dedicated taxi route to bypass congested surface roadways.

At the time of the spin-off, TBC was initially registered in Delaware, but the name was changed to Nevada in March 2023.

Neuralink

Neuralink, a privately held company founded by Musk in 2016, announced last week that it had changed its legal entity from Delaware to Nevada.

xAI

Musk’s Artificial intelligence (AI) xAI was founded in March 2023 and was originally incorporated in Nevada. The company will open to the public in July 2023, announcing at that time that “xAI’s goal is to understand the nature of the universe.”

Musk previously served on the board of nonprofit research firm OpenAI, which rose to prominence during the AI ​​boom and has a partnership with Microsoft, but was closed down in 2018 over disagreements over the safety of AI. He resigned as director.
